This is one of those breads I can't quit eating. The flavor is full bodied and astounding. This is no Wonder Bread! It needs no butter or any other spread to be good.
This bread recipes calls for 6 1/4 cups of flour. I replaced 3 of those cups with whole wheat flour and increased the water by 1/4 cup. I also added 2 T of vital gluten. We prefer whole grains and this change was perfect to our tastes. I didn't have any chives so used only diced onions. (The recipe includes both options.) I grated... Read more

This is delicious! Everyone loved it. My six-year-old niece said it was, "The best bread in the whole world." The house smells so good while it is cooking. I used chives and a combination of cheddar, asiago and a little parmesan. I made one batard and one Kranz style in a loaf pan.
Easy to make, everyone should try it!
